Chapter 1:
How the Hell did this Happen?



I had thought out all of the possibilities of what was going to happen. However I never thought it would end up like this……

Waking up from being knocked unconscious with something that felt like a bat, I found myself in a large stone room with candles lit all around as if we were going to be locked in darkness. I tried to think back and figure out who, or in my case what, had attacked me.
I heard a pair of footsteps heading my way and as they entered the room I closed my eyes trying to pull off as still unconscious. If they were a shifter then they’d be able to see through my disguise but lucky for me they weren’t. I heard someone walk towards me and felt a hand hovering over my face but didn’t give the clue that said that I knew. I felt the hot hand wavering over my head and at that moment my eyes opened to stare at the two people in front of me. One of the two was a small women about five four with long curly blond hair that shaped her face perfectly. I looked up to her face to see that she had brown eyes that looked as if she could crawl into the depths of your soul. She was wearing a small red tank top that said that she wasn’t shy and skinny jeans with black high heels. I looked beside her to the man that had his hand in my face. I would have told him to get it out of my face before I cut it off but I didn’t. Seeing as how I was tied up in what looked like a basement and had no clue where I was.
Still looking at the man I examined him up and down, left and right trying to memorize his face just in case I escaped this place and he was still alive. I made sure that if I didn’t die that I would kill him for not helping me. He was tall, almost reaching six foot if he wasn’t already there. The dark brown hair that brushed against the lashes of what looked like green eyes glowed against the light of the candle like he had descended from some other worldly place that humans knew nothing about. I relaxed the tense muscles that I hadn’t known had tightened up and my mind began to go to that dark place that I went to, to survive and kill what needed to be killed to fulfill that eagerness.
I looked up to stare at the man that had his hand in my face and apparently he saw something he didn’t like or didn’t expect. “What are you” he asked jumping back like he was dodging a fist. “In all of my years I have never seen such, rage”
“What are you talking about?” this from Barbie “there is no rage in her in fact there is nothing” she turned and looked back from the tall dark and handsome to me.
“I assure you that it is anger that I am sensing. But to this extent their should be no human able to remain sane. ”
“Ah, how sweet. I don‘t know if I should take that as an insult or a compliment” I said annoyed by the fact that I was still here. I should be home, tucked in beside Shane and asleep by now. I had gotten a call while in the middle of eating supper and had to run out to police station to get one of my little friends out of jail and hadn’t had time to get back home after dropping him out at his house before getting attacked out of nowhere and well, here I am.
“It was meant to be a compliment” he said looking at me with a face that told me he was interested in me for some reason.“ I have answered your question and yet I have not gotten an answer out of you. Now answer me!”
“Fine, what do you want to know” I asked as I sighed. I already knew that I wouldn’t be sleeping any time soon so I just gave up.
“Do not play coy” Barbie demanded. For some reason I had gotten her panties in a wad but I didn’t know what had caused it. I looked over to her and yet again the darkness filled me and I felt nothing. She flinched as if I had burnt her and turned away towards the man.
“I will not repeat myself again. What are you?” he asked in a strained voice
“What are you?” I asked. I knew that annoying the people who had me restrained wouldn’t be a good idea but I was getting tired of playing 20 questions.
He came towards me and was so close that I could feel his chest rise and fall as he breathed. “Do not defy me. If you will not talk willingly then I will make you” He reached out to me and was fixing to touch my neck.
At that moment I knew what he was and what he was going to do. Before he got any closer I thought about death, the kill, and my powers flung out into the empty space like a wild fire that was slow at first but spread like water in the end. He backed up and a slow growl escaped his throat.
I felt a power rise from the hall. I dropped mine as he walked in and something about him made me wince. “Justin!” he said and apparently that one word was enough since the man in front of me turned and walked out the door.
If I hadn’t heard her breathe I would have forgotten that Barbie was still in the room. She looked startled to see the man in the doorway come near her and as he did she began to kneel and raised one fist to her chest. Whatever was going on here I already knew that I wouldn’t like it, so I kept quiet hoping that they would forget about me.
The man walked around her to me so that I could get a better view. He, like Justin, was around six foot with a few inches to spare. He had brilliant black wavy hair that matched the perfect midnight blue eyes and tan that I couldn’t tell if he was born with or not. I knew that he was muscular just from looking at him since there were lines poking out from under his shirt that had muscle written all over it. He wasn’t one of those that over did the work out schedule instead it was like he had been made to have that perfect body from birth. While I was caught up in my own thoughts he had covered the last few yards between us without me noticing. Trust me I was paying attention now.
He had reached out for me the same as the other man had done but this time I decided it was best not to tick the man holding me hostage off . Yeah, that sounded like a good idea. I expected something a little more aggressive from him I don’t know why he just seemed like that type of man that had that macho attitude and I‘ve noticed that it‘s the almost always the tough men who go down first and it‘s quite amusing. Not the whole death thing but those men who act all freaking high and mighty and tick you off are usually the ones that you see crying for their moms in the end and that just seems well……hilarious!
Stepping out of La La Land and into reality I noticed that the hand that was placed on the side of my face was now caressing my cheek. He moved his hand to my forehead and smoothed my bangs to the side of my face so that my scar was noticeable. I had gotten the scar from a dhamphir who was nine years old and a hundred and twenty at the same time. She had been playing makeover with me and decided to place a scar on my forehead that looked like a moon to mark me for her master. What happen to her exactly? Let’s just say when I finally got out she didn’t want to play with me anymore, go figure.
“So you are lady death?” the man in front of me asked. “I would have figured you to be, how do I say, more intimidating” he placed his figures on my head and began tracing the scars. “I would have never thought of how beautiful and petite you would be”
Did he just call me small? He did not just call me small. I tried my best to be a good girl but there is one thing I can’t stand and he just hit the jackpot. I raised the anger that I had been kept hidden and it rose to the surface of my skin like a shield to block his icy touch with my fiery rage. He took a step back and wrapped his hand up in his own like I had burnt him. I expected him to hit me or something similar to that thought but he did nothing, he just backed away and walked across the room out the door with a grin on his face. What the hell? I was usually good at ticking people off, just ask Barbie, but today I must be off my game. Huh? I guess I need to work on it.
